Field Service Engineer The Field Service Engineer is responsible for providing onsite system diagnostic and analytical support to customers within a geographic territory, or assigned to a specific account, supporting the customer per the terms of the SLA (Service Level Agreement) with Park Place Technologies. Specifically, the FSE responds to customers' systems failures by way of computer hardware service, testing, diagnostic analysis, and systems analysis of hardware, storage area networks, and system configurations. An FSE must be available to respond to customer issues 24/7 and service all equipment regardless of product training within the designated service area. They also must have a thorough and broad knowledge of system configuration and equipment compatibility requirements and limitations across various OEM product lines. The FSE has the skillset to review machine logs internal to the device. As an FSE, you must be willing to participate in After Hours Support Team (if assigned) - providing first response to incoming customer service requests after normal business hours - or hours as assigned per customer contract. The customer support center may field and coordinate calls during scheduled and unscheduled hours. What you'll be doing: Provides onsite technical customer support: Ensures timely, professional, and effective response to customer service needs to maintain a high level of customer satisfaction. Must be able to be scheduled for work on shifts occurring at any time of day. Provides effective problem analysis and identification remotely before arrival at customer site; determines needed parts and documentation to minimize down time and multiple trips Performs service in a cost effective manner. Displays professional attitude and courtesy while on site. Maintains effective communication with customer and our customer support center during repair process and any projected delay. Analyzes software and hardware error logs, utilizes diagnostic and troubleshooting techniques and operating system analysis to ensure timely and effective repair. Analyzes, diagnoses, troubleshoots and repairs hardware, storage area network and systems configuration and compatibility problems. Utilizes multiple tools for remote system connection to perform remote diagnosis, repair or configuration changes. Follows customer specific repair procedures. Assesses current and future customer needs based on usage of the system. Inventory / Parts Management: Determines needed parts and quantities based on contracts in service area. Returns bad or excess parts in a timely manner. Manages accurate inventory count, daily and as required and performs bi-yearly physical count inventory. Administrative: Accurately completes and timely returns audit forms, email replies, timesheets and expense reports. Attends and participates in regularly scheduled team meetings. Accounts for all activities correctly using Field Point time reporting utility.
